How 2:
 Almost entirely created with MSX-SVI
 728 (believe me, precalcing those
 remapping tables on Pascal takes 
 ages..), except for some graphics, 
 which were drawn with Deluxepaint on
 PC. Yeah, I'm ashamed, but I don't see
 any options on MSX1 without a mouse..

 - Hard: 
   - Spectravideo 728 MSX
   - Spectravideo 707 floppy drive

 - Soft:
   - GEN80-assembler
   - SKMSX text editor
   - Borland Turbo Pascal
   - Microsoft Disk Basic
   - MSX-DOS 1.0

Why:
 Writing this one was a living hell, 
 literally. It's definitely not easy
 to write software with an over decade
 old homecomputer, most of the tools 
 are mainly clumsy and slow. So why 
 bother? I spent the last two months 
 writing players, routines and effects, 
 literally hating myself and the tools
 I used. And still, as you can see, the
 result is nothing impressive. It's all
 been done before on an 8-bit computer.
 Probably not MSX1, but who cares? C64
 has a lot of better intros and these 
 machines are all just the same. Right?
